Lieutenant Commander Laria Herren (Federation Basic: [laɹiʌ hɛɹən]) Age 27, Trill (Unjoined) Female (she/her)
Primary Character - Mission Specialist/Second Officer

Third primary character. An unjoined Trill who started her career in the Starfleet Diplomatic Corps. After bouncing between assignments and picking up a smattering of expertise in various fields, she landed aboard the Constitution-B as a mission specialist. After proving herself to her commanding officer, she was promoted to lieutenant commander and second officer. Laria is a strait-laced and by-the-book officer who sometimes still acts as rigidly as an ensign fresh out of the Academy. In addition to her Starfleet career, she is undergoing field evaluation by her field docent as a candidate for joining with the Trill Symbiosis Commission. Off-duty, she enjoys cooking (for real), skiing, watching old Trill movies, and dancing.

Master Chief Petty Officer (ret.) Vada (Federation Basic: [vɛədɑ]) Age 126, El-Aurian Female (she/her)
Secondary Character - Independent Journalist - INACTIVE

Second secondary character. A childhood survivor of the assimilation of El-Auria, Vada went on to settle on Earth with her mother, and enlisted in Starfleet as soon as El-Aurianly possible. Her Starfleet career lasted 72 years, spanning from a torpedo bay technician to a senior instructor at Starfleet Academy for a few decades. Unable to cope with the idea of facing the Borg once again, she retired in good standing from Starfleet after the Battle of Wolf 359. She wrote for the FNS during the Dominion War and would go on to have a healthy career as an independent journalist. Her four-year story researching the aftermath of the destruction of Romulus is considered among her best work. In the months leading up to Frontier Day she arrived in the Alpha Isles, and is currently a passenger aboard the USS Khitomer.
